🎫 👻 History & Haunts

Yes, Cave Hill is the final resting place for many notable figures, including boxing legend Muhammad Ali, KFC founder Colonel Sanders, and explorer George Rogers Clark.TikTokInstagram+2

While primarily known for its historical significance and arboretum, some visitors and content creators explore its 'spooky' or 'morbid' aspects, hinting at potential paranormal lore.TikTok+2

Established in 1846, Cave Hill is a 296-acre Victorian-era National Cemetery and arboretum, featuring stunning monuments and serving as a final resting place for thousands.TikTokInstagram+1

Visitors often remark on the artistry of the memorials, including sculptures of dancing couples, playing children, and unique tributes like dog headstones.TikTokReddit

Exploring the Arboretum

Cave Hill Cemetery & Arboretum is more than just a burial ground; it's a designated arboretum boasting a remarkable diversity of trees and plant life.TikTok Established in 1846, the grounds are meticulously maintained, offering a serene escape into nature. Visitors can admire seasonal blooms, from the vibrant cherry blossoms and magnolias of spring TikTok+2 to the rich tapestry of fall foliage.TikTok The Maidenhair Gingko tree is a particular highlight, known for its rapid color change and dramatic leaf drop.TikTok

For nature enthusiasts and photographers, the arboretum provides endless opportunities. The presence of various bird species, including owls and songbirds, adds to the natural charm.TikTokInstagram+2 While some trees are labeled, many visitors express a wish for more detailed identification markers.Reddit Regardless, the sheer beauty and tranquility of the arboretum make it a compelling reason to visit, offering a peaceful contrast to the historical monuments.

Notable Figures and Unique Memorials

Cave Hill Cemetery is the final resting place for a remarkable array of influential figures, making it a significant historical landmark.TikTokInstagram+1 Among the most famous are boxing legend Muhammad Ali, KFC founder Colonel Sanders, and American frontiersman George Rogers Clark. The cemetery also honors local heroes and innovators, such as Derek E. Smith, credited with inventing the 'high five'.Reddit

Beyond the famous names, the cemetery is renowned for its exceptionally artistic and unique memorials. Visitors are often moved by the intricate sculptures depicting everyday life, such as a husband and wife dancing, children playing, or a magician.Reddit One particularly poignant memorial features Jesus holding ropes for a little girl's playground swing.Reddit The cemetery also features touching tributes to beloved pets, including dog headstones, adding a unique and personal touch to the landscape.TikTokReddit These diverse and often deeply personal memorials contribute to the cemetery's profound sense of history and human connection.
